人事部门管理系统的ER图怎么画? | i人事一体化HR系统 | HR必知必会

人事部门管理系统的ER图怎么画?

人事部门管理系统er图

如何绘制人事部门管理系统的ER图

在企业信息化和数字化实践中,人事部门管理系统的设计至关重要。ER图(实体关系图)作为数据库设计的核心工具,能够清晰地展示系统中各个实体及其关系。本文将详细讲解如何绘制人事部门管理系统的ER图,并探讨在不同场景下可能遇到的问题及解决方案。

1. 确定实体及其属性

首先,明确系统中的核心实体及其属性是绘制ER图的基础。在人事管理系统中,常见的实体包括员工、部门、职位、考勤记录、薪资信息等。每个实体应具备其独特的属性,例如员工实体可能包含员工ID、姓名、性别、入职日期等属性。

案例:在设计员工实体时,除了基本信息外,还需考虑员工的联系方式、紧急联系人等扩展属性,以确保系统的全面性。

2. 识别实体间的关系

识别实体之间的关系是ER图设计的核心步骤。在人事管理系统中,员工与部门之间存在“属于”关系,员工与职位之间存在“担任”关系,考勤记录与员工之间存在“记录”关系等。明确这些关系有助于构建系统的逻辑结构。

案例:员工与部门之间的关系可以表示为“员工属于部门”,这种关系在ER图中通常用连线表示,并标注关系类型。

3. 定义关系的基数

关系的基数描述了实体之间的数量关系。例如,一个部门可以有多个员工,但一个员工只能属于一个部门,这种关系可以表示为“一对多”。定义关系的基数有助于确保数据的完整性和一致性。

案例:在员工与职位的关系中,一个员工可以担任多个职位,但一个职位只能由一个员工担任,这种关系可以表示为“多对一”。

4. 处理复杂关系和继承

在某些情况下,实体之间的关系可能较为复杂,例如多对多关系或继承关系。处理这些关系时,需要引入中间实体或使用继承机制。例如,员工与培训课程之间可能存在多对多关系,可以通过引入“员工培训记录”实体来解决。

案例:在员工与培训课程的关系中,引入“员工培训记录”实体,记录员工参与培训的时间、成绩等信息,从而简化多对多关系的处理。

5. 考虑系统扩展性和灵活性

在设计ER图时,需充分考虑系统的扩展性和灵活性。随着企业的发展,人事管理系统可能需要新增实体或调整现有关系。因此,设计时应预留足够的扩展空间,例如通过引入通用属性或模块化设计。

案例:在设计薪资信息实体时,可以预留“自定义字段”属性,以便未来根据企业需求灵活调整薪资结构。

6. 审查和优化ER图

最后,审查和优化ER图是确保系统设计合理性的关键步骤。通过审查,可以发现潜在的设计缺陷或冗余关系,并进行优化。优化后的ER图应简洁明了,逻辑清晰,便于后续开发和维护。

案例:在审查过程中,发现员工与考勤记录之间的关系可以通过引入“考勤规则”实体来简化,从而提高系统的可维护性。

推荐利唐i人事

在人事管理系统的设计与实施过程中,选择一款功能全面、易于扩展的系统至关重要。利唐i人事作为上海利唐信息科技有限公司开发的一体化人事软件,涵盖了集团管理、组织人事、智能档案、考勤排班、OA审批、薪资计算、六项扣除、招聘管理、绩效管理、培训管理、人才发展等多个模块,适合大中型企业及跨国企业使用。其国际版本更是为跨国企业提供了便捷的解决方案,帮助企业实现控本提效。

通过以上步骤,您可以绘制出符合企业需求的人事部门管理系统ER图,并结合利唐i人事的强大功能,实现企业信息化和数字化的高效管理。

利唐i人事HR社区,发布者:hiHR,转转请注明出处:https://www.ihr360.com/hrnews/20241291538.html

(0)